Which is the most difficult fort in Maharashtra?

In the Western Ghats near Mumbai, at a hefty altitude of 701 metres (2,300 feet) above sea level lies the world’s most dangerous fortress: Kalavantin Durg, which (according to legend) was constructed in honour of a Queen Kalavantin.

Is Kalsubai trek difficult?

The trek is moderately difficult, passing through lush paddy fields, jungles, small streams, highlands and rocky terrains, and takes around 3-4 hours, with short intervals in between, to reach the crest of Kalsubai. The base village is Bari Village, which is nestled at the foothills of Kalsubai mountain.

Which is the biggest fort?

1. Chittorgarh Fort, Rajasthan – Largest Fort in India. Chittorgarh Fort is the biggest fort in India, and also a World Heritage Site. Spread over about 2.8 kms and 400 acres and the highest elevation in the fort is at about 1075 metres.

Which fort is in water?

Murud-Janjira Fort is situated on an oval-shaped rock off the Arabian Sea coast near the port city of Murud, 165 km (103 mi) south of Mumbai. Janjira is considered one of the strongest marine forts in India.

What is difficult trekking?

Pin Parvati, Goechala, Kanamo, Everest Base Camp, Warwan Valley are few of the difficult Himalayan treks. Pin Parvati Pass is classified as a difficult trek because of rough terrain, incredible altitude gain and the high risk level of the trek. Exit is nowhere in the picture either once trekkers enter the trail.

Is Kalsubai trek good for beginners?

TREKKING AT KALSUBAI DIFFICULTY LEVEL: EASY TO MEDIUM. -Although a long trek, there are stairs which continue till the top of the peak. The metal ladder which is in good condition has been placed in rough patches which might be difficult to climb. Thus,making it quite accessible to beginner trekkers.

Is Kalsubai Trek safe?

Truly, it’s everything safe except you simply need to avoid potential risk: First of all, it is the most elevated top in Kalsubai trek in Maharashtra so it is steep yet it has railings or iron stairs to it.

Which is the most difficult trek in Maharashtra?

AMK Trek and Lingana are the massive pinnacle and considered the most difficult trek in Maharashtra, followed by Tailbaila Trek, Kalavantin Durg and Harihar Fort. Salher is the highest fort in Maharashtra, located in Nasik district. The fort is the highest hill fort and second highest peak of the Sahyadris range.

Is Kalavantin Durg Trek toughest Trek in Maharashtra?

Above 250 Feet Sea Level, the Kalavantin Durg Trek is said to be one of the toughest trek in Maharashtra. With steep gradient, narrow routes and rough terrain – the kalavantin durg trek is not for the inexperienced trekkers (beginners). In the year 1657, the fort was controlled by the Maratha Empire.

Is Alang Madan Kulang the most difficult trek in Maharashtra?

Since it demands these high-level skills for a two-day trek, Alang Madan Kulang is known to be the most difficult trek that one can do in Maharashtra. You must have heard about the sentence, “higher the risks, higher the rewards”. This trek proves that by providing the most stunning views from the plateau on the top of the forts.

Which is the toughest place in Nasik district for trekking?

AMK are the toughest places in the sahyadris for trekking or Alang along with Madangad and Kulang are the most difficult trek in Nasik district. Trek To Ghangad And Tailbaila is one of the two rock climbing trek,situated in Lonavala region.
